因此,ESMA 认为,根据目前适用的 EMIR 制度,这些 TC-CCPs 不能继续
在欧盟被认可。自撤销决定实施之日起,这些 TC-CCPs 将不能够继续向欧盟境
内设立的清算会员和交易场所提供服务。
为了减轻对欧盟市场参与者的不利影响,ESMA 将把撤销决定的实施日期推
迟到 2023 年 4 月 30 日。
ESMA to Withdraw the Recognition Decisions of Six Indian CCPs (2022/10/31)
The European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A), the EU’s
financial markets regulator and supervisor, today announces that six central
counterparties (CCPs) established in India will have their recognition decisions
withdrawn in accordance with the European Market Infrastructure Regulation
(EMIR).
ESMA had to tier and review the recognition of all third country CCPs
(TC-CCPs) that had been recognised prior to 21 September 2020, in accordance with
EMIR (Article 89(3c)). Among these TC-CCPs, six are in India, namely:
The Clearing Corporation of India (CCIL), supervised by the Reserve Bank
of India (RBI);
Indian Clearing Corporation Limited (ICCL), supervised by the Securities
and Exchange Board of India (SEBI);
NSE Clearing Limited (NSCCL), supervised by SEBI;
Multi Commodity Exchange Clearing (MCXCCL), supervised by SEBI;
India International Clearing Corporation (IFSC) Limited (IICC), supervised
by the International Financial Services Centre Authority (IFSCA); and
